Who, What, Whereand When.....

Who: You, your friends, family and thousands of attendees!

What: Sample the North Shore’s top restaurants featuring seafood specialties including fresh lobster, homemade chowder, succulent shrimp, fried clams & all the New England Favorites!

• Dance to the best regional bands around including:Don’t Call Me Shirley, Lisa Love Experience and Hooda Thunk, with nonstop entertainment on the Salem Willows Shell.

• Learn new recipies and sample Culinary masterpieces at the Pat Whitley Restaurant Show Culinary Demonstrations tent; showcasing the region’s most famous chefs.

• Kiddie Land with games, face painting and activities.

• Local arts, craftsmen & merchants.

• Beverage Courtyard serving beer and wine.

sPeCIal events:Lobster Roll Eating Competition Saturday at 2:00PMSpectacular Fireworks display Saturday at 9:30PM*Rain Date Sunday at 9:30PMLobster Plunge Sunday at 2:00PM

Where: Salem Willows, 187 Fort Avenue, Salem MA 01970

When: July 11, 12, 13, 2014. Friday 12:00PM-10:00PM; Saturday 11:00AM-10:00PM; Sunday11:00AM-10:00PM

ParKIng & trolley servICe:We want you to ENJOY the festival, so save yourself the aggravation of driving to the Willows to find NO Parking! The best way to get to the festival is to park at one of the satellite lots with shuttle service provided by Salem Trolleys for $5 round-trip or $3 one-way with children under 10 free. Take Salem Trolleys from one of the following locations.

• National Park Visitors Center, Essex Street, Salem, MA• Shetland Properties, 29 Congress St, Salem, MA

*Saturday and Sunday only.• Hawthorne Hotel, 18 Washington Square W, Salem, MA

*Parking for hotel guests only• Salem Waterfront Hotel, 225 Derby St, Salem, MA

*Parking for hotel guests only• Train Station, 252 Bridge St Salem, MA • Salem Ferry Landing, 10 Blaney St, Salem, MA

festIval admIssIons:• $5 per Adult with children under 10 FREE.

Senior Discount offered on Friday from 12:00PM-4:00 with a $2 admission for anyone over the age of 60.

* A portion of admissions goes back to support the City of SalemParks & Recreation Department.
